Musings Of A Mid Summer Evening

1
God declares another spell of sound sleep;
Men and women continue to pray,
Drought, hunger and conflicts rage...
Nothing hopeful happens ever.
2
The Indo-Sino reminders of 1960s
Recede into oblivion.
Bloodstreams may still run
And we shall ever enjoy brotherhood.
3
One dies in an accident
Another one commits suicide,
One dies at a murderer’s knife.
Survival is a great feeling.
4
The tears of the mother are seen again;
The utterances of the son are heard,
Where is the rhythm of life?
5
Butterflies have gone to die;
Dragon flies have flown to wild bushes,
Where shall I search for a relief?
6
In my garment I hide myself,
In their eyes I look naked.
An oasis is needed across this desert.
